Challenge Trophy rescheduled for September 29

Message from RDC Promotions

We are very pleased to confirm this week that following the unfortunate cancellation of the June 17 event at Mildenhall Stadium, RDC Promotions has received the blessing from fellow BriSCA F2 Stockcar promoters to reschedule the long running F2 Challenge Trophy at the last Mildenhall meeting of the season on September 29. 

A special thanks must go to our Scottish colleagues at GMP who have a BriSCA F2 Stockcar meeting scheduled at Cowdenbeath on September 29. All championship fixtures are supposed to be solos dates but GMP gave their blessing for this date to feature the Challenge Trophy despite them running their meeting on the same night and we are pleased that this Cowdenbeath fixture will be unaffected. 

The September 29 fixture will also the white and yellow grade series final for the BriSCA F2 Stockcars but a final decision will be made nearer the time on the exact format of the meeting as to whether the white and yellow grade series final doubles up as a heat race to determine qualifiers for the Challenge Trophy as, especially given the lack of F2 racing at Mildenhall in June, we very much want to run a Grand National at this meeting.

Again a meeting format will be confirmed in due course, but the Challenge Trophy will be the final of the meeting which will run a traditional heat and consolation format and the September 29 programme also features the all RWD National Bangers RDC RWD Championship and Ministox and is hopefully going to be another fine night of full contact racing at Mildenhall.
